On Sun, May 31, 2009 at 06:08:23PM -0400, Jorge Arellano Cid wrote:
> On Sun, May 31, 2009 at 07:55:27PM +0000, corvid wrote:
> > > annoyed by the slow source view widget I'd like to play with
> > > a source viewer dpi (Jorge, I think you suggested to use a
> > > dpi instead of coding it in dillo directly).
> > > However I want to avoid to reload the page from the dpi, as I want
> > > to be able to view the source exactly as it is currently displayed.
> > > 
> > > How should I pass the html document from dillo to the dpi? Any
> > > ideas?
> > 
> > Can you borrow the start_send_page stuff used to send local files to dillo?
> 
>   That's the idea.
> 
>   You  have  to pass the source to the dpi to create a table with
> the line number. That way you have the handy line number and find
> text functionality.
> 
>   Something like:
> 
>   <table>
>    <tr><td>1
>        <td> LINE_CONTENT_HERE
>    <tr><td>2
>        <td> LINE_CONTENT_HERE
>        ...
>   </table>

Yes, that will be the fun part :) I also think about an option to
pass the html to tidy to make it more readable.
However first I need to get the html from dillo to the dpi. Is
the start_send_page already working in that direction or is a new
equivalent method needed?
